Siemens SENTRON 3VA1150-6EF32-0DH0 — 50 A MCCB with Undervoltage Release
The Siemens SENTRON 3VA1150-6EF32-0DH0 is a 3-pole molded case circuit breaker (MCCB) rated for line protection, carrying a continuous current of 50 A at 40 °C and derating to 45 A at 70 °C. Its interrupting capacity reaches 220 kA at 240 V AC and 154 kA at 415 V AC — figures that place it in the high-breaking-capacity class for industrial distribution panels where fault currents can exceed 100 kA.
At 440 V the breaker interrupts 121 kA; at 500 V and 690 V the rating drops to 17 kA — a steep fall that reflects the arc-extinction limits at higher voltages. For a 480 V panel (common in North America), the 121 kA at 440 V is the closest published figure; the 17 kA at 500 V governs above that threshold. Thermal derating is flat from 40 °C to 50 °C (50 A), then drops by 1 A per 5 °C step to 45 A at 70 °C. That means a panel ambient of 55 °C still allows 49 A continuous — within tolerance for most 50 A feeders.
The breaker measures 130 mm high, 76.2 mm wide, and 70 mm deep — a footprint that fits standard Siemens SENTRON 3VA panel-mounting cutouts. The 3-pole design with screw terminals accepts copper or aluminum conductors sized per the manufacturer's terminal range (not listed here, but typical for a 50 A frame).
